    Six persons E, L, M, N, D and O are sitting in a row facing towards east (not necessarily in the same order). M is third to the right of O. Both O and M do not sit at extreme ends. Only three persons sit between O and L. If N is neighbour of M, then who are the neighbours of O?

    A.

    D and L

    B.

    E and N

    C.

    D and E

    D.

    D and N

    Correct option is C

    Given:
    M is third to the right of O.
    Both O and M do not sit at extreme ends.
    Only three persons sit between O and L. 
    If N is neighbour of M.
    From the given statement arrangement will be:
    So, O's neighbors are D and E.
    Thus, the correct option is: (c)
